Record ID: YORYM-0219E8
Object type: STRAP END
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: North Yorksh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
Fragment of a copper-alloy strap-end of Thomas's Class B, Type 5. Only the lower half survives, and the break is an irregular tear across the centre which has resulted in the loss of the attachment end and the rivets. The surviving part is filled with a single field of interlace in deep counter-relief. It tapers to the slightly raised terminal, which is in the form of an animal's head. The head is neatly modelled, with deep relief ears, pointed-oval eyes, and a nose formed from a double moulding. The reverse is flat and undecorated, apart from an incised faint line around the outer ed…

Record ID: YORYM-01F580
Object type: WEIGHT
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: East Riding of Yorksh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
A small cast lead weight with rounded edges and a flat base. Into the top of the weight a styca coin has been pressed. The coin is not otherwise identifiable. The lead is a light greyish-brown colour. A similar weight can be seen in the Yorkshire Museum's collection (Pirie, p282). This Viking weight dates from the 9th or 10th century. This object was found along with YORYM-022143 styca of Aethelred and YORYM-01F154 lead weight.

Record ID: YORYM-01C134
Object type: WEIGHT
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: East Riding of Yorksh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
Viking-age weight made from copper alloy with an iron core. The weight is roughly globular, with some flattened facets. One of the flattened facets is decorated with a ring made up of small stamped circles. Inside the ring is a swastika motif, but part of the motif has worn away revealing the brassy colouring of the metal. Opposite this there is a large lump of cracked and damaged copper alloy. On either side of the weight there are two further areas of damage and/or corrosion of the core. The metal is a dark reddish-brown colour. This type of 'truncated sphere' weight is one of the …

Record ID: LANCUM-008151
Object type: ROTARY QUERN
Broad period: ROMAN
County: Cumbria
Workflow stage: Published Find published
An almost complete set (three larger and possibly two smaller fragments) of a rotary quern for grinding grain to create flour, probably dating from the Roman period, i.e. AD43-410, although similar household rotary querns were in use until the 19th century. Earlier examples of similar shape (called 'beehive querns', see examples in Ingle 1993/4, 21-33.) were also in use in the later pre-Roman Iron Age, but a Roman date is the most likely one for this rotary quern. Two of the images show the complete lower half on the right and half of the upper part on the left; the smaller fragments m…
